RE: [PHP-DB] Weird Windows SQL

2002-04-24 Thread Peter Lovatt

have you set up permissions for the user you are connecting as?
see  GRANT in the MySql manual. The test bit is a default setting for users
with no privileges (from my slightly rusty memory)
